.datepicker-container[data-v-6615ac10]{display:inline-block;position:relative}.datepicker-input-wrapper[data-v-6615ac10]{align-items:center;display:flex;position:relative}.datepicker-input[data-v-6615ac10]{background:#fff;border:1px solid #ccc;border-radius:var(--border-radius);box-sizing:border-box;color:#3a3a3c;cursor:pointer;font-size:18px;font-weight:700;height:60px;padding:16px 40px 16px 16px;width:100%}.datepicker-input[data-v-6615ac10]:focus{border-color:var(--purple);box-shadow:0 0 2px var(--purple);outline:none}.datepicker-icon[data-v-6615ac10]{cursor:pointer;font-size:20px;position:absolute;right:16px;-webkit-user-select:none;-moz-user-select:none;user-select:none}.calendar-container[data-v-6615ac10]{background:#fff;border:1px solid var(--purple);border-radius:var(--border-radius);box-shadow:0 2px 10px #0003;left:0;min-width:350px;padding:8px;position:absolute;top:calc(100% + 8px);width:auto;z-index:10}.calendar-header[data-v-6615ac10]{align-items:center;display:flex;justify-content:space-between;margin-bottom:8px}.calendar-month[data-v-6615ac10],.calendar-year[data-v-6615ac10]{cursor:pointer;font-weight:700;margin:0 8px}.calendar-nav-btn[data-v-6615ac10]{background:none;border:none;cursor:pointer;font-size:18px}.calendar-grid[data-v-6615ac10]{display:grid;gap:4px;grid-template-columns:repeat(7,1fr);text-align:center}.calendar-day-name[data-v-6615ac10]{font-weight:700}.calendar-day[data-v-6615ac10]{border-radius:var(--border-radius);cursor:pointer;padding:8px 0}.calendar-day--disabled[data-v-6615ac10]{color:#ccc;cursor:default}.calendar-day[data-v-6615ac10]:hover:not(.calendar-day--disabled){background-color:#eee}.calendar-day--selected[data-v-6615ac10]{background-color:var(--purple);color:#fff}.calendar-day--today[data-v-6615ac10]{outline:2px solid var(--purple)}.month-picker[data-v-6615ac10],.year-picker[data-v-6615ac10]{display:grid;gap:8px;grid-template-columns:repeat(4,1fr);text-align:center}.year-picker[data-v-6615ac10]{max-height:200px;overflow-y:auto;text-align:center}.month-cell[data-v-6615ac10],.year-cell[data-v-6615ac10]{border-radius:var(--border-radius);cursor:pointer;padding:8px;white-space:nowrap}.month-cell[data-v-6615ac10]:hover,.year-cell[data-v-6615ac10]:hover{background:#eee}.year-picker-arrow[data-v-6615ac10]{display:inline-block;font-size:10px;margin-left:4px;transition:transform .3s ease;vertical-align:middle}.year-picker-arrow.rotated[data-v-6615ac10]{transform:rotate(180deg)}.input-error[data-v-6615ac10]{border-color:red;box-shadow:0 0 2px red}.datetext-container[data-v-c1581e6d]{display:inline-block;position:relative}.datetext-input-wrapper[data-v-c1581e6d]{align-items:center;display:flex;position:relative}.datetext-input[data-v-c1581e6d]{background:#fff;border:1px solid #ccc;border-radius:var(--border-radius);box-sizing:border-box;color:#3a3a3c;cursor:pointer;font-size:18px;font-weight:700;height:60px;padding:16px 40px 16px 16px;width:100%}.datetext-input[data-v-c1581e6d]:focus{border-color:var(--purple);box-shadow:0 0 2px var(--purple);outline:none}.datetext-icon[data-v-c1581e6d]{cursor:pointer;font-size:20px;position:absolute;right:16px;-webkit-user-select:none;-moz-user-select:none;user-select:none}.input-error[data-v-c1581e6d]{border-color:red;box-shadow:0 0 2px red}.phone-wrapper[data-v-4e6a22f2]{display:flex;flex-direction:column;width:100%}[data-v-4e6a22f2] .v-field{background-color:transparent!important;border:1px solid #ccc;border-radius:var(--border-radius);height:60px}[data-v-4e6a22f2] .v-field__overlay{background-color:transparent!important}[data-v-4e6a22f2] .v-field:focus-within{border-color:var(--purple)!important;box-shadow:0 0 2px var(--purple)!important;outline:none!important;transition:border-color .3s ease}[data-v-4e6a22f2] .v-input__details,[data-v-4e6a22f2] .v-field__outline{display:none}[data-v-4e6a22f2] .vue-tel-input__input:focus{border-color:var(--purple)!important;box-shadow:0 0 2px var(--purple)!important;outline:none!important}[data-v-4e6a22f2] .v-field__field{grid-area:auto!important;width:100vw}[data-v-4e6a22f2] .v-label{color:#a1a1a1;font-size:16px;opacity:1!important}[data-v-4e6a22f2] .v-field__input{box-sizing:border-box;color:#3a3a3c;font-size:18px;font-weight:700;height:60px;line-height:1.4}[data-v-4e6a22f2] .v-field{overflow:hidden}.checkbox-label[data-v-ed529ac1]{align-items:center;cursor:pointer;display:flex}.checkbox-input[data-v-ed529ac1]{-moz-appearance:none;appearance:none;-webkit-appearance:none;border:2px solid var(--purple);border-radius:4px;height:20px;margin-right:8px;position:relative;width:20px}.checkbox-input[data-v-ed529ac1]:checked{background-color:var(--mint-green);border-color:var(--purple)}.checkbox-input[data-v-ed529ac1]:checked:after{color:var(--purple);content:"✓";font-size:16px;left:3px;position:absolute;top:0}.checkbox-label-text[data-v-ed529ac1]{color:var(--text-color,#333);margin-left:5px}.form-field[data-v-e27fa1c4]{display:flex;flex-direction:column;font-size:18px;margin-bottom:24px}.form-field__container[data-v-e27fa1c4]{display:flex;flex-direction:column;position:relative}input:not(:-moz-placeholder-shown)+.form-field__label[data-v-e27fa1c4]{color:var(--purple);font-size:16px;top:-8px;transform:translateY(-7%) scale(.85);transform-origin:left center}.form-field__container--focused .form-field__label[data-v-e27fa1c4],input:not(:placeholder-shown)+.form-field__label[data-v-e27fa1c4],select:focus+.form-field__label[data-v-e27fa1c4]{color:var(--purple);font-size:16px;top:-8px;transform:translateY(-7%) scale(.85);transform-origin:left center}.form-field__label[data-v-e27fa1c4]{background:#fff;color:#a1a1a1;font-size:16px;left:16px;padding:0 6px;pointer-events:none;position:absolute;top:50%;transform:translateY(-50%);transition:all .2s ease;z-index:1}.form-field__input[data-v-e27fa1c4],.form-field__textarea[data-v-e27fa1c4]{border:1px solid #ccc;border-radius:var(--border-radius);box-sizing:border-box;color:#3a3a3c;font-size:18px;font-weight:700;height:60px;line-height:1.4;padding:16px}.form-field__textarea[data-v-e27fa1c4]{height:120px;min-height:120px}.form-field__input[data-v-e27fa1c4]:focus,.form-field__textarea[data-v-e27fa1c4]:focus{border-color:var(--purple);box-shadow:0 0 2px var(--purple);outline:none}.form-field__select-wrapper[data-v-e27fa1c4]{color:#3a3a3c;font-size:18px;font-weight:700;line-height:1.4;position:relative;width:100%}.form-field__select-trigger[data-v-e27fa1c4]{align-items:center;background-color:#fff;border:1px solid #ccc;border-radius:var(--border-radius);cursor:pointer;display:flex;font-size:18px;justify-content:space-between;padding:16px;transition:border-color .3s ease}.form-field__select-trigger.open[data-v-e27fa1c4]{border-color:var(--purple);box-shadow:0 0 2px var(--purple)}.form-field__select-arrow[data-v-e27fa1c4]{transition:transform .3s ease}.form-field__select-arrow.open[data-v-e27fa1c4]{transform:rotate(180deg)}.form-field__select-options[data-v-e27fa1c4]{background-color:#fff;border:1px solid #ccc;border-radius:10px;box-shadow:0 2px 10px #0000001a;left:0;list-style:none;margin-top:4px;padding:0;position:absolute;top:100%;width:100%;z-index:10}.form-field__select-option[data-v-e27fa1c4]{cursor:pointer;font-size:16px;padding:12px 16px;transition:background-color .3s ease}.form-field__select-option[data-v-e27fa1c4]:hover{background-color:var(--purple-light);color:#fff}.form-field__error[data-v-e27fa1c4]{color:red;font-size:14px;margin-top:4px}.form-field__select-option[data-v-e27fa1c4]:first-child{border-top-left-radius:10px;border-top-right-radius:10px}.form-field__select-option[data-v-e27fa1c4]:last-child{border-bottom-left-radius:10px;border-bottom-right-radius:10px}.static-button[data-v-12f8c717]{align-items:center;background:linear-gradient(145deg,var(--pink-light),var(--pink-dark));border:2px solid var(--pink-dark);border-radius:var(--border-radius);cursor:pointer;display:inline-flex;font-size:15px!important;font-weight:800;font-weight:700!important;gap:8px;height:50px;height:7vh;justify-content:center;line-height:22.5px;outline:none;padding:12px 24px;text-align:center;-webkit-text-decoration-skip-ink:none;text-decoration-skip-ink:none;text-underline-position:from-font;transition:all .3s ease}@media screen and (min-width:480px) and (max-width:1536px){.static-button[data-v-12f8c717]{font-size:12px}}.static-button[data-v-12f8c717]:focus{outline:2px solid var(--pink-dark)}.static-button[data-v-12f8c717]:not([disabled]):hover{background:linear-gradient(145deg,var(--pink),var(--pink-dark));box-shadow:inset 1px 1px 3px #fff6,inset -1px -1px 3px #00000040,6px 6px 8px #00000026;filter:brightness(1.1);transform:translateY(-2px)}.static-button[data-v-12f8c717]:not([disabled]):active{background:linear-gradient(145deg,var(--pink-dark),var(--pink));box-shadow:inset -2px -2px 4px #fff3,inset 2px 2px 4px #0000004d,2px 2px 4px #0003;transform:translateY(0)}.static-button[disabled][data-v-12f8c717]{box-shadow:none;opacity:.6;pointer-events:none}.icon-size[data-v-12f8c717]{font-size:2.8rem;line-height:1;vertical-align:middle}@media screen and (max-width:768px){.icon-size[data-v-12f8c717]{font-size:3.4rem}}.rotated-icon[data-v-12f8c717]{transform:rotate(90deg);transition:transform .3s ease}
